Santé is seeking a F ull -time OPS Crisis Call Center Supervisor/Coordinator (in office)  to join our frontline crisis intervention team in  Baltimore County, MD . As an OPS Call Center Coordinator Leader, you will provide oversight of daily OPS/GBRICS functions in coordination with the Deputy Director and Call Center Manager. The OPS Coordinator will work with management and ensure guidance and administrative oversight for call center employees.

 

What You’ll Do:  


  • Develop, approve, and monitor Call Center work schedules and ensure all shifts are covered 24/7, 365.

  • Will supervise and train Team Lead positions in the call center.

  • Able to fill Phone Counselor shifts if needed.

  • Responsible for on call availability regarding scheduling/ administrative concerns.

  • Administrative supervision of call center staff ensuring all requirements are met by staff.

  • Will be responsible for reviewing call center cases and ensuring accurate documentation and follow up.

  • Ensures accurate, thorough, and timely documentation of all calls.

  • Responsible for interviewing all call center staff and onboarding process once hired. 

  • Serves as a liaison between management and call center staff and employees. 

  • Ensures open communication on all matters related to GBRICS policies, procedures, and any updates.

  • Regular meetings with Team Lead(s) to identify any current issues concerns or implementation of new policies/procedures.

  • Provides ongoing communication with GBRICS managers, both the call center Manager and the MRT Director.

  • Identifies any cross-program concerns between GBRICS Call Center and MRT and works with management team to develop increased communication or program improvements. 

  • Assists with record releases per client/agency request.

  • Checks work e-mail according to agency protocol.

  • Participates in and completes all required training.

  • Knowledge and familiarity with community resources, both mental health and non-mental health.

  • Active participation in the ongoing development of the program database.

  • Ensures staff can complete an environmental risk and safety assessment and relays all information to MCT/patrol when necessary. 

  • Ensure all tasks related to each case are completed during each shift worked.

  • Recognizes need for consultation with available supervisor.

  • Abide by all federal, state and local confidentiality and reporting regulations.

  • Comply with all of programs contractual and operational guidelines as outlined by your manager.

  • Participates in community and company boards and committees, as needed.

  • Advise Clinical Management of needed updates to procedures, policies and documentation.

  • Other duties as assigned.

 

  What We Require:  


  • This is a Supervisory  position, providing guidance and oversight for OPS/GBRICS Phone Counselors and Team Leads.

  • Master's degree in Counseling, Social Work, or related field of study preferred. 

  • Bachelor's degree in Counseling, Social Work, or related field of study required. 

  • Previous Crisis and Call Center experience required. 

  • Supervisory experience required.

  • Knowlege of Microsoft Office software.

  • Must be able to be training on Electronic Consumer Record software.

The employee in this role is considered Essential Personnel.
